Rwanda - Re-Export of Machines for Mixing Mineral Substances with Bitumen

Since 2011, Rwanda Re-Export of Machines for Mixing Mineral Substances with Bitumen jumped by 229.6% year on year. In 2016, the country was number 7 comparing other countries in Re-Export of Machines for Mixing Mineral Substances with Bitumen with $77,819. Rwanda is overtaken by Namibia, which was number 6 at $80,318.17 and is followed by United States with $58,675. Jordan topped the ranking with $360,258.04 in 2019, that is a fall of 29.6% versus 2018. Uganda, Yemen and Guyana resp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Rwanda witnessed the best average annual growth at +229.6% per year, while United Arab Emirates was the worst growing country at -50.3% per year.
